MAX33040E/MAX33041E +3.3V, 5Mbps CAN Transceiver with 40V Fault Protection, 25V CMR, and 40kV ESD in 8-Pin SOT23 General Description Benefits and Features The MAX33040E/MAX33041E are +3.3V control area net- Integrated Protection Increases Robustness work (CAN) transceivers with integrated protection for in- Increased Protection on CANH and CANL dustrial applications. These devices have extended 40V 40V Fault Tolerant fault protection on CANH and CANL for equipment where 40kV ESD Human Body Model (HBM) overvoltage protection is required. They also incorporate Protection high 40kV ESD HBM and an input common-mode range 25V Extended Common-Mode Input Range (CMR) of 25V on CANH and CANL, exceeding the ISO (CMR) 11898-2 CAN standard of -2V to +7V. This makes these Short-Circuit Protection parts well suited for applications where there is moderate Transmitter Dominant Timeout Prevents Lockup electrical noise that can influence the ground levels be- Thermal Shutdown tween two nodes or systems. These parts feature a shut- Family Provides Flexible Design Options down pin and a multifunction standby pin. Slow Slew Rate to Minimize EMI These devices operate at a high-speed CAN data rate, al- Low-Current Standby Mode lowing up to 5Mbps on short distance networks. Maximum Small Package Options to Save PCB Area speed on large networks may be limited by the number 8-Bump WLP of nodes, the type of cabling used, stub length, and oth- 8-Pin SOT23 er factors. The MAX33040E/MAX33041E include a dom- 8-Pin SOIC inant timeout to prevent bus lockup caused by controller High-Speed Operation of up to 5Mbps error or by a fault on the TXD input. When TXD remains Operating Temperature Range of -40C to +125C in the dominant state (low) for longer than t , the dri- DOM ver is switched to the recessive state, releasing the bus Ordering Information appears at end of data sheet. and allowing other nodes to communicate. These devices feature a STBY pin for three modes of operation stand- by mode for low current consumption, normal high-speed mode, or a slow slew-rate mode when an external 39.2k resistor is connected between ground and STBY pin. The MAX33040E is available in an 8-bump WLP and 8-pin SOT23, while the MAX33041E is available in an 8-pin SOIC package. Both parts operate over the -40C to +125C temperature range.
